Irish in Britain is the only national charity that serves the Irish community in Britain by campaigning,researching, supporting and representing Irish community organisations.

On Saturday 05 October we are running the Cuimhne 10 K Run in Richmond Park.

We are running to raise money to help Cuimhne recruit, train and pay out of pocket expenses for an army of 50 volunteers to help Cuimhne deliver a better quality of life, independence and dignity for Irish people experiencing memory loss. Cuimhne will also be supporting family carers so they may receive some respite and care.  

If you can help you will be directly helping Irish elders with dementia and their family carers here in Britain.
